Claude for Excel
by Anthropic
Anthropic's native Excel add-in, part of Claude for Microsoft 365. Reads multi-tab workbooks, explains formulas with cell-level citations, builds models. Pro $17/mo annual.
Microsoft Copilot Cowork
by Microsoft
Microsoft's cloud-based agentic AI for M365, powered by Anthropic's Claude. Multi-step tasks across Outlook, Teams, Excel, PowerPoint, Word with Work IQ context. $30/user/month add-on.

Pros & Limitations
Editorial assessmentClaude for Excel
Pros
- ✓Cell-level citations with clickable navigation: every explanation traces back to specific cells, formulas, and tabs, providing audit-ready transparency that competitors using AI inside Excel routinely lack
- ✓Native shared context across Claude for Excel, PowerPoint, Word, and Outlook via the Claude for Microsoft 365 suite: analysts can build a comps table in Excel and carry that data into a pitch deck without re-explaining the dataset
- ✓Enterprise gateway flexibility through Amazon Bedrock, Google Cloud Vertex AI, and Microsoft Foundry: regulated industries can route inference through existing cloud providers without forcing a new vendor relationship through Anthropic's direct API
Limitations
- ⚠Not yet captured in Enterprise audit logs or Compliance API and does not inherit custom data retention settings: a material gap for procurement teams in regulated industries (financial services, healthcare, legal) that require full action traceability before deploying AI in spreadsheets
- ⚠VBA macros, pivot table refreshes from external connections, and some Power Query operations are outside the current scope, requiring manual work for workflows that depend on those Excel features
- ⚠Prompt injection risk in untrusted spreadsheets: Anthropic explicitly warns against using Claude for Excel with downloaded templates, vendor files, or external data imports, since malicious instructions can be hidden in cells, formulas, or comments
Microsoft Copilot Cowork
Pros
- ✓Runs inside the customer's M365 tenant under existing Microsoft Enterprise Data Protection: inherits the same compliance posture as M365 E5, IT teams already know how to manage it, and no separate procurement or governance review is needed for organizations already on M365
- ✓Work IQ context layer pulls from emails, files, meetings, Teams, and SharePoint automatically: meaningfully better cross-app reasoning than agents that require explicit data source connection per task, with no manual coordination required
- ✓Built on Claude Sonnet 4.6 and Opus 4.6 with the same agentic harness as Claude Cowork: delivers Anthropic reasoning quality with Microsoft enterprise observability, governance, and the Critique dual-model review feature for complex research tasks
Limitations
- ⚠Cannot interact with local files, applications, or third-party tools outside M365: end-to-end workflows touching non-Microsoft systems require additional connectors or fall back to manual handoff, a real constraint versus Claude Cowork's desktop-and-cloud flexibility
- ⚠EU, EFTA, UK, and government cloud tenants face deployment blockers: Anthropic sub-processor disabled by default, no in-region Claude processing committed, government cloud blocked entirely; organizations with strict data residency requirements need to wait for regional availability
- ⚠Still in Frontier preview with no committed GA date and requires an existing M365 Copilot license as a prerequisite: the effective cost is approximately $60 per user per month when the underlying Copilot license is included, limiting adoption to well-funded Microsoft-first enterprises

How does pricing compare between Claude for Excel vs Microsoft Copilot Cowork?
Claude for Excel uses a subscription model, starting at $17 per month. Microsoft Copilot Cowork uses a subscription model, starting at $30 per month.
